On Tue, Sep 25, 2007 at 04:02:52PM -0400, bfields wrote:
> I think we should try to keep the git documentation mostly confined to
> tools that are distributed with git itself.  So it might be worth a few
> words just to mention the existance of tailor and how it compares to
> other tools, but I'd leave it at that.

So in fact it might be that what's needed isn't any new documentation on
the available tools with their features and limitations.

I know that when I recently had to deal with a svn tree the hardest part
was figuring out where to start (git-svn?  git-svnimport?).  I seem to
recall threads here suggesting this is a general problem.

One exception--the "series of tarballs" thing--I think it's cool that
you can just unpack a bunch of tarballs and string them together into a
git history.  It gives a good sense of how git works, and I don't think
it's documented explicitly anywhere.  I think that might be kinda fun to
write up.  But I haven't tried.
